The role..

We’re looking for a People Business Partner to join ITV on a permanent basis, supporting our Finance division and reporting directly to our Head of People.

In this role, you’ll act as a trusted advisor to leaders and managers, helping to develop and deliver strategic people plans that align with ITV’s ambitions. You’ll provide proactive, solutions-focused support across a broad range of people matters, championing inclusion, building line manager capability, and promoting a high-performance culture. You’ll also play a key role in implementing organisational change, handling employee relations issues, and driving continuous improvement across the People function.

This is a brilliant opportunity for someone who thrives in a fast-paced, collaborative environment and is passionate about making ITV an excellent place to work.

Some of your key day-today responsibilities will include:

  • Develop strong ties with Finance chiefs and overseers, offering mentorship and support
  • Provide expert advice and challenge to support effective people management and decision-making.
  • Support the delivery of ITV’s People and D&I strategies, embedding a culture of inclusion and high performance.
  • Partner with the Head of People to build and implement strategic people plans aligned to ITV’s “More than TV” strategy.
  • Lead and support organisational design initiatives, restructures, and change projects.
  • Handle a range of employee relations matters, including sickness absence, performance, flexible working, and informal complaints.
  • Identify and handle operational risks, supporting compliance with ITV People policies and legal obligations.
  • Provide people data insights and reporting to influence business decisions.
  • Support or lead on People-related projects, frameworks, and policy development.
  • May line handle People Managers and contribute to the development of the wider People team.
  • Drive continuous improvement by working with Centres of Expertise to deliver a high-quality, professional service.
  • Stay up to date with employment law and HR standard processes.
